ld-musl-*.so* is a symlink "broken" for the hostsystem, so wildcard
will skip it, causing LD_MUSL_NAME to empty and the ldd symlink pointing
to ../../lib directly.
This causes sysupgrade failing to copy any linked libaries and
consequently failing to run anything after switching to ram disk.
Fix this by creating a symlink directly pointing to where ld-musl-*.so*
points to.
